数字逻辑 作者 王茜 黄仁 许光辰 第6章数字系统功能模块设计.pptVIP

  • 2
  • 0
  • 约4.79千字
  • 约 39页
  • 2017-07-07 发布于广东
  • 举报

数字逻辑 作者 王茜 黄仁 许光辰 第6章数字系统功能模块设计.ppt

目前一种快速通道的设计就是利用直接存取存储器(Direct Memory Access,DMA)技术,而DMA是让集成电子器件(Integrated Device Electronics,IDE)直接存取存储器内容 早期IDE接口有两种传输方式:一个是PIO(Programming I/O)方式技术;另外一个就是DMA方式。虽然DMA方式系统资源占用少,但需要额外的驱动程序或设置,因此当时被接受的程度较低。随着计算机系统速度越来越高,DMA方式由于执行效率较好,操作系统也开始直接支持,因此厂商就推出了愈来越快的各种DMA传输速度标准 基于可编程器件技术支持的高速传输通道应具备如下6个需求: (1)在准备进行数据传输时,可以向传输通道控制器发送请求; (2)传输通道控制器根据设备传输申请,对系统管理器发送总线占用申请标志; (3)系统管理器利用总线空闲期释放总线,并回送总线可用标志; (4)传输通道控制器得到该信号后,发送传输首地址指针和向传输设备发回答信号,同时发 I/O读和内存写信号; (5)传输设备得到回答信号,将数据送到数据总线上,同时撤除数据传输申请; (6)内存接收数据后,回送准备好信号,传输通道控制器内部地址寄存器加1(减1),且内部计数器减1,并撤除总线请求。 6.4.2 多处理机共享数据保护锁设计 在多机系统中常涉及多个处理器对共享资源访问冲突问题,一种简单可行的

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档